That's the control grid (G1). It should rise to around 100-115V as you advance brightness to maximum. Does it?
In other words, its bias relationship to the cathode (pin 11) should be at or near 0V at max brightness.
What is the voltage directly at the brt.control wiper as you turn the control stop-to-stop? What is the voltage at the top (hot) terminal lug of the control? Just for the heck of it, check for continuity in the wire going from the wiper to pin 2 (just on the chance there might be a break in that wire).

Thanks again everyone here is what I found...
on the far end of the 100K resister (R35) it reads 330 volts, after it crosses R35 the voltage drops to 0.69 volts which is the input to the Brightness Control. The wiper of the brightness control seems to vary the voltage from stop-to-stop at 0.04 volts at min to 0.67 volts with the dial turned to max and this is what is output to Pin 2 of the picture tube cap. The continuity of the wire is just fine, but always good to check! Old_Coot88 are you saying with the brightness turned up Pin 2 the output of the wiper should be 100 to 115volts? If so 0.69 volts is obviously way off.
